Transaction 5ecb686fef4fe9aeda79a2490c6598d2a6d0cac116fc236be84178f9d87a9025

1 Input
2 Outputs
  • 5ecb686fef4fe9aeda79a2490c6598d2a6d0cac116fc236be84178f9d87a9025:0
  • value  2236764
    address  3Ptdfr2khvFaC2durLLneSunVazEcZQkbE
  • 5ecb686fef4fe9aeda79a2490c6598d2a6d0cac116fc236be84178f9d87a9025:1
  • value  460989125
    address  1CV5DigeEddcCg1s6FPhCkfR6TWCHcBmPS